There are three courses of commercial driver license: A, B, and C. The kind of license you’ll get depends largely on what sort of truck driver you wish to be. Class A: Trucking forecasts This is the kind of license most truck drivers have. It provides you the freedom to drive nearly each sort of heavy obligation automobile, from business trucks to flatbed and tractor trailers, even tankers. You’ll be a extremely employable CDL driver with a class A license. Class B: That is the license for the kind of operator who drives all the pieces from metropolis buses to highschool buses or handles trash assortment for development sites. Class C: A class C driver handles passenger transportation or cargo in a smaller vehicle than different drivers.
